Windows 10中,可通过“设置”或“控制面板”进入网络连接属性,手动配置DNS服务器地址,如谷歌8.8.8.8和阿里云223.5.5.5等。
Win10的DNS设置
DNS的作用
DNS(Domain Name System,域名系统)是互联网的一项服务,它作为将域名和IP地址相互映射的一个分布式数据库,能够使人更方便地访问互联网,而不需要记住复杂的IP地址,在Win10系统中,正确配置DNS可以优化网络连接速度、提高上网稳定性,甚至增强网络安全性。
常见的公共DNS服务器
公共DNS | 首选DNS地址 | 备用DNS地址 |
---|---|---|
谷歌DNS | 8.8.8 | 8.4.4 |
阿里云DNS | 5.5.5 | 6.6.6 |
腾讯DNS | 29.29.29 | 254.116.116 |
Win10中DNS的设置方法
(一)通过“设置”应用程序配置DNS
- 打开设置:点击Windows 10左下角的“开始”按钮,选择“设置”。
- 进入网络和Internet:在设置界面中,选择“网络和Internet”。
- 选择网络连接:根据你的网络环境,选择“以太网”或“WiFi”。
- 高级网络设置:点击“更改适配器选项”,找到你的网络连接,右键点击并选择“属性”。
- 配置DNS:在属性窗口中,选择“Internet协议版本4(TCP/IPv4)”,点击“属性”,选择“使用下面的DNS服务器地址”,输入首选和备用DNS服务器地址,如谷歌的8.8.8.8和8.8.4.4。
(二)通过“控制面板”配置DNS
- 打开控制面板:点击“开始”菜单,选择“Windows系统”,然后点击“控制面板”。
- 进入网络和Internet:在控制面板中,选择“网络和Internet”,然后点击“网络和共享中心”。
- 更改适配器设置:在左侧菜单中选择“更改适配器设置”。
- 选择网络连接:找到你当前使用的网络连接,右键点击并选择“属性”。
- 配置DNS:同样选择“Internet协议版本4(TCP/IPv4)”,点击“属性”,然后手动设置DNS服务器地址。
(三)通过命令提示符配置DNS
- 打开命令提示符:在“开始”菜单中搜索“命令提示符”,右键点击并选择“以管理员身份运行”。
- 查看网络适配器名称:输入命令
netsh interface show interface
,找到你的网络适配器名称。 - 设置DNS:使用命令
netsh interface ip set dns name="适配器名称" source=static addr=首选DNS地址
设置首选DNS,使用netsh interface ip add dns name="适配器名称" addr=备用DNS地址 index=2
添加备用DNS。
相关问题与解答
(一)问题
-
设置DNS后无法上网怎么办?
- 解答:首先检查DNS地址是否输入正确,确保没有输错数字或标点符号,如果确认无误,可以尝试重置网络适配器,在命令提示符中输入
netsh int ip reset
命令,然后重启电脑,若问题仍然存在,可能是网络本身存在问题,如路由器故障、网络欠费等,需要进一步排查网络环境,也可以尝试更换其他公共DNS服务器地址,看是否能够解决问题。
- 解答:首先检查DNS地址是否输入正确,确保没有输错数字或标点符号,如果确认无误,可以尝试重置网络适配器,在命令提示符中输入
-
如何清除DNS缓存?
- 解答:在命令提示符中输入
ipconfig /flushdns
命令,然后按回车键,系统会显示“已成功刷新DNS解析缓存”的提示信息,表示DNS缓存已成功清除,清除DNS缓存有助于解决因缓存中的旧记录导致的网络问题,例如访问某些网站
- 解答:在命令提示符中输入